When Is the Perfect Time to Explore Mono, Benin

When planning a trip to Mono, timing is everything! The best time to visit this captivating region is during the dry season, which typically runs from November to March. During these months, you can expect sunny skies and pleasant temperatures, making it ideal for outdoor activities and beach days. The dry season also coincides with several local festivals, allowing travelers to experience the vibrant culture of Mono firsthand.

However, if you’re looking to avoid the crowds and enjoy a more tranquil experience, consider visiting during the shoulder seasons of April to June and September to October. While there may be occasional rain, the landscapes are lush and green, creating a picturesque backdrop for your adventures. Indulge in the Culinary Delights of Mono, Benin

Mono is a culinary paradise, offering a delightful array of dining options that reflect the region's rich cultural heritage. From street food stalls to upscale restaurants, there's something to satisfy every palate. Start your culinary adventure by sampling local street food at bustling markets. Here, you can find mouthwatering dishes like akassa, a fermented corn dish typically served with savory sauces, and fresh seafood caught daily by local fishermen.

For a more formal dining experience, explore some of the region's restaurants that showcase traditional Beninese cuisine. Many establishments pride themselves on using fresh, locally sourced ingredients to create delicious meals that highlight the flavors of Mono. Don't miss trying the famous poulet braisé, grilled chicken marinated in spices, often served with a side of fried plantains or rice. Pair your meal with a refreshing local drink, such as palm wine or ginger juice, for a true taste of the region.

Exciting Festivals and Events in Mono, Benin

One of the most delightful aspects of visiting Mono is the opportunity to partake in its lively festivals and events. These celebrations are a reflection of the region's vibrant culture and are filled with music, dance, and culinary delights. The annual Voodoo Festival, celebrated in January, is one of the most significant events in the region, attracting visitors from all over. This festival showcases traditional rituals, colorful parades, and performances that honor the Voodoo religion, providing a unique insight into the local culture.

Another notable event is the Grand-Popo Festival, which celebrates the local fishing community and their traditions. This lively festival features boat races, fishing competitions, and cultural performances that highlight the importance of fishing in the community's way of life. Practical Tips for a Smooth Trip to Mono, Benin

Planning a trip to Mono, Benin, can be exciting, but being prepared with practical tips can enhance your experience. First and foremost, it's important to familiarize yourself with the local currency, the West African CFA franc (XOF). ATMs are available in larger towns, but it's wise to carry some cash for smaller transactions, especially in local markets. When it comes to safety, Mono is generally a safe destination, but typical travel precautions apply. Stay aware of your surroundings, avoid displaying valuables, and opt for reputable transportation options.

Language can be a consideration as well; while French is the official language, many locals speak various indigenous languages. Learning a few basic phrases in French can go a long way in connecting with the community. Additionally, embracing the local customs and etiquette, such as greeting people warmly and showing respect for cultural practices, will enhance your interactions and experiences.

Lastly, pack appropriately for the climate, which can be hot and humid. Lightweight, breathable clothing is recommended, along with sun protection and insect repellent. If you're planning to engage in outdoor activities, sturdy footwear is essential.
